Dilmurat Batur

Uyghur-Chinese footballer

Dilmurat Batur (simplified Chinese: 迪力木拉提·巴吐尔; traditional Chinese: 迪力木拉提·巴吐爾; pinyin: Dílìmùlātí Bātǔěr; Uighur: دىلمۇرات باتۇر; born 6 July 1989) is a Chinese footballer who currently plays for China League Two side Suzhou Dongwu.

Club career

Dilmurat played for China League Two club Xinjiang Sport Lottery between 2006 and 2009. He joined Chinese Super League side Shenzhen Ruby along with his teammate Abduwali Ablet and Yehya Ablikim on 18 March 2011. He made his senior debut on 10 April 2011 in a 1-0 home defeat against Shaanxi Renhe, coming on as a subs*ute for Seiichiro Maki in the 60th minute. Dilmurat played as a regular subs*ute player in the 2011 season, gaining 17 league appearances, however, Shenzhen Ruby relegated to the second tier by finishing the last place of the league.

In January 2014, he moved to Oman and signed a six-month contract with Al-Oruba on a free transfer.

On 4 February 2015, Dilmurat transferred to China League One side Qingdao Jonoon.
